  • the present invention relates to a method of preparing an emulsion- or asphalt-concrete for use as a road material.
  • the technique is based on the use of a bitumen emulsion in admixture with a graded stone material.
  • An aqueous bitumen emulsion has no particular bonding ability of its own, but in time a so-called 'breaking' of the emulsion occurs, whereby the emulgated bitumen fractions float together and the water is segregated, such that the bitumen may thereafter act as a binding agent that can stick to the stone surfaces and bond these together.
  • By means of different additives it is possible to control rather accurately when this breaking should take place after the mixing operation. It is achievable, therefore, that the mixture can be prepared and transported to the laying area and be laid-out therein prior to the breaking having proceeded to the point where the material will not thereafter be suitably easily shapeable.
  • bitumenous binding agent It is the purpose of the invention to provide a method, by which it will be practically possible to make use of an emulsion based on a noticeably harder bitumen i.e. a bitumen of higher viscosity, such that the laid out road layer can exhibit a considerably increased strength and yet be suitably shapeable in connection with the laying-out, without thereafter being sensible to any washing out of the bitumenous binding agent.
  • the invention is based on the consideration that the material as a whole will be supple and shapeable as long as the fine stone fraction has not been bonded by a high viscid bitumen, whether or not the stones in the coarse fraction have already been wrapped by a more or less broken emulsion based on a high viscid bitumen.
  • the finally admixed emulsion will make the entire mixture supple and formable, i.e. the mixture can be laid out evenly and with ordinary equipment, although the stones of the coarse fraction have already been coated with a layer of broken, hard bonding bitumen.
  • the coarse stone fraction is heated to such a high temperature, by which the stones can be totally coated by the initially added high viscid bitumen, which, itself, is heated to assume a viscosity suitably low for this purpose.
  • the fine fraction is added to the mixer, in either cold or warm condition all according to the applied low viscid bitumen, which is also added; this bitumen should have a temperature high enough to condition such a low viscosity that the bitumen can effectively coat the stone particles of the fine fraction.

  • this bitumen may have a viscosity e.g. in the range of 5000 - 75000 mm 2 /sec at 60° C.
  • the viscosity of the relevant bitumen should normally be somewhat lower that 3000 mm 2 /sec, but under special circumstances this figure may be higher, e.g. up to 4-5000, though still noticeably smaller than the viscosity figure of the applied high viscid bitumen.
  • the weight ratio between the two kinds of bitumen may vary all according to the dispensary og the material mixture, but a typical ratio can be 60%PC% high viscid and 40%ZC% low viscid bitumen.
  • a typical ratio can be 60%PC% high viscid and 40%ZC% low viscid bitumen.
  • the applied mixing plant can be a simple batch mixer or a continuous throughflow mixer, but it would be possible to use separate mixers for the mixing of the respective binding agents into the respective stone fractions and a separate mixer for the bringing together of the thus pretreated fractions.
  • the hard emulsion can be dosed in accordance with the desired maximum carrying capacity of the stones of the coarse fraction, while a dilution of the emulsion would cause a weakening of this carrying capacity and thereby of the possibility of an efficient exploitation of the high viscid bitumen.

Abstract

Dans de la production de béton émulsionné destiné à être posé sous forme de matériau routier, il est habituel de mélanger les morceaux de pierre à un liant constitué d'une émulsion bitumineuse à base de bitume relativement peu visqueux facilitant la mise en forme du matériau pendant l'opération de pose. On a prévu de soumettre les morceaux grossiers de pierre à un traitement préalable avec une émulsion à rupture rapide et à base de bitume fortement visqueux, puis d'ajouter le mélange de petits morceaux de pierre et de liant peu visqueux. On arrive ainsi à maintenir l'aptitude du matériau à être mis en forme, tout en assurant une liaison sensiblement améliorée du matériau posé.
